Saipem, Subsea7 file intended merger for EU approval

By Jean Comte ( June 16, 2026, 19:32 GMT | Insight) -- Energy services companies Saipem and Subsea7 have requested the EU Commission's approval for their intended merger, according to a notification on the regulator's register of deals. The commission has set a provisional deadline of July 22 to decide on the deal.Energy services companies Saipem and Subsea7 have notified their intended merger with the European Commission on Tuesday, according to an update on the regulator's register of deals....
